Children’s author Karen M. Greenwald finds interactive ways to connect history’s hidden heroes to the world of today's children.

Ms. Greenwald's Non-Fiction Picture Book, A VOTE FOR SUSANNA, THE FIRST WOMAN MAYOR is the first/only book about a woman who fought her town's bullies, became an international icon, and cemented the unique 1887 Kansas law permitting women to run and vote in municipal elections. Based in years of intricate research, including personal ephemera written by Mayor Salter, several women mayors across the United States are supporting this book.
A Phi Beta Kappa, Magna cum laude, Alpha Sigma Nu graduate of Georgetown University, Ms. Greenwald holds a JD from Georgetown University Law Center. -- adapted from https://sharem -

Mary Boone has ridden an elephant, jumped out of an airplane, hung out backstage with a boy band, and baked dozens of cricket cookies – all in the interest of research for her books and magazine articles. She’s written more than 70 nonfiction books for young readers, ranging from inventor biographies to how-to craft guides.

Mary grew up in rural Iowa. Prior to writing books, she reported and edited for several daily newspapers.
She now lives in Tacoma, Washington, with her husband, Mitch, and children, Eve and Eli. Mary loves being outdoors, reading, and hanging out with her very energetic Airedale Terrier, Ruthie Bader. -
